It will NOT come back on later at any point automatically. To restart it, you would have to remove the
power connection and reconnect it to reset the charger.
The result is that the charging procedure is quite simple, plug a 120 Volt AC or 240 Volt AC power
source into the provided charging port, and walk away. You may also use the J1772 style plug that is
provided under the rear license plate.

If using a typical electric plug at home, you would use a normal NEMA 5-15 three-prong male plug.
You would connect the female end of a HEAVY extension cord into it, and the male end of that cord
into an ordinary wall receptacle.
The vehicle comes equipped with a heavy duty 12 gauge three conductor extension cord quite
suitable for charging from 120 VAC outlets. Also provided is a heavy duty NEMA 14-50 adapter. This
is the type of connector most often found on electric ranges but also at RV parks across the country.
This adapter will connect the two phases
of 240 VAC service to the two blade
prongs of the charge port, and the neutral
of the two phases to the ground pin.
The battery pack in the vehicle is
completely isolated from the frame of the
vehicle and ground. So grounding the
circuit accomplishes nothing in any event.
In this way, you can use the same charge
port from either 120 Volt AC or 240 Volt AC
